Subject: [PATCH] Make sure sockets implement splice_read
Date: Thu, 14 Feb 2008 18:53:34 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<200802141853.35016.rdenis@simphalempin.com> (raw)

Fixes a segmentation fault when trying to splice from a non-TCP socket.

Signed-off-by: Rémi Denis-Courmont <rdenis@simphalempin.com>
---
 net/socket.c |    3 +++
 1 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/socket.c b/net/socket.c
index 7651de0..b6d35cd 100644
--- a/net/socket.c
+++ b/net/socket.c
@@ -701,6 +701,9 @@ static ssize_t sock_splice_read(struct file *file, loff_t *ppos,
 {
 	struct socket *sock = file->private_data;
 
+	if (unlikely(!sock->ops->splice_read))
+		return -EINVAL;
+
 	return sock->ops->splice_read(sock, ppos, pipe, len, flags);
 }
